+/*
+ Read from IO_CACHE when it is shared between several threads.
+ It works as follows: when a thread tries to read from a file
+ (that is, after using all the data from the (shared) buffer),
+ it just hangs on lock_io_cache(), wating for other threads.
+ When the very last thread attempts a read, lock_io_cache()
+ returns 1, the thread does actual IO and unlock_io_cache(),
+ which signals all the waiting threads that data is in the buffer.
+*/
